The last decade has seen enormous changes in the way the European Union and China do business, with the evolving relationship set to remain tense in the coming years.
These were among the sentiments expressed by speakers and delegates at a high-level EU-China business conference organised by Friends of Europe, a Brussels-based think-tank, on Wednesday (9 December).
